Whole house batteries, also known as home energy storage systems, are large-scale batteries designed to store electricity for use during outages or times of high demand. They integrate with your home's power system, allowing you to draw energy when needed-whether it comes from solar panels, the grid, or both.

Benefits of Whole House Batteries
Energy Independence
Tired of being at the mercy of your utility company? Whole house batteries let you take control. By storing your own energy, you can significantly reduce your reliance on the grid. This is especially valuable in areas prone to blackouts or unreliable power service.
Reduced Electricity Bills
Batteries help you avoid peak electricity rates. You can charge the battery when electricity is cheap and use it during peak hours, effectively reducing your monthly bill. Plus, if you have solar panels, you can store excess energy instead of sending it back to the grid for minimal compensation.
Backup Power During Outages
Whether due to storms, grid failures, or unexpected disruptions, power outages are a hassle. With a whole house battery, your home remains powered, keeping essential appliances running smoothly.
Environmental Impact
By storing solar energy, you reduce your carbon footprint and dependence on fossil fuels. This helps promote a greener, more sustainable future.
Increased Home Value
Investing in a whole house battery can boost your home's resale value. Buyers are increasingly attracted to energy-efficient and self-sufficient properties.
Best Practices for Installing Whole House Batteries
🔋 Choosing the Right Battery Size
Size matters. Your battery should be large enough to meet your household's energy demands. A typical home might need a 10-20 kWh battery, but larger households or those with extensive solar setups may require more capacity.
🛠️ Proper Installation and Maintenance
Professional installation is key. Batteries must be installed by licensed electricians to comply with safety standards. Regular maintenance, such as cleaning terminals and monitoring performance, ensures longevity.
⚙️ Optimizing Energy Usage
Use smart energy management systems to schedule when your battery discharges. This ensures you maximize savings by using stored energy during peak pricing hours.
🔥 Safety Considerations
Safety first. Ensure proper ventilation and temperature regulation around the battery. Overheating or poor ventilation can reduce efficiency and lifespan.
